Robert Brusa wrote:
> Since migrating from eCOS V2.0 to the most recent one (from CVS), I am
> stuck with the problem that I can no longer configure eCOS to support
> SPI. Using eCos Configuration Tool 2.net UNSTABLE (Oct 9 2008 16:37:05)
> I select the hardware "Atmel AT91SAM7XEK evaluation board" default
> packages. The resulting configuration does not include support for SPI.
> The package CYGPKG_IO_SPI is missing. However, an attempt to add this
> package ("Generic SPI-support" using configtool) is blocked with the
> error message:
>
> Add and remove hardware packages by selecting a new hardware template.
>
> Well ok, but how do I do this? Thanks and best regards
CYGPKG_IO_SPI is correctly declared as a hardware package in ecos.db.
eCos targets which use this package must therefore include it in their
target descriptions. I note that this package is missing from the
at91sam7xek target description in ecos.db. You should therefore add
CYGPKG_IO_SPI to this record by editing ecos.db directly.
